The LAKWAR 60x-120x Mini Pocket Microscope is a portable, handheld device designed for both kids and adults. Weighing only 61g and measuring 6x3.4x9 cm, it offers 60-120X magnification to explore microscopic details of various specimens. The kit includes 5 prepared slides, features a built-in LED light for enhanced visibility, and is perfect for educational purposes or outdoor exploration.

This isn't really a handheld microscope. It works best if you use it on a flat surface - tabletop. Tying to focus this and look through it while holding it and what you are trying to look at will result in frustration. I like the two kinds of lights = regular white light, and the UV light. Using the UV light requires you to press and hold down the button to keep the light on, the regular light operates with an on/off switch. The microscope come with a nylon carrying case - and a selection of pre-prepared slides. The stuff on the slides is pretty random selection - fly & bee parts for example. Fun if you have never looked at such things using a microscope. The one double-A battery seems more than adequate, the cover on the battery compartment seems a bit loose and might be something that could potentially pop off. I'm happy with my purchase.
